Ein tiefer Einblick in die verschiedenen Selektortypen in jQuery

王林
Freigeben: 2024-02-28 18:06:03
Original
343 Leute haben es durchsucht

Ein tiefer Einblick in die verschiedenen Selektortypen in jQuery< p>

jquery ist eine weit verbreitete javascript-bibliothek, die häufig in der webentwicklung eingesetzt wird. in jquery sind selektoren ein sehr wichtiges konzept, das es entwicklern ermöglicht, dom-elemente basierend auf bestimmten bedingungen auszuwählen und zu betreiben. durch den kompetenten einsatz von selektortypen können entwicklungseffizienz lesbarkeit des codes erheblich verbessert werden. diesem artikel befassen wir uns eingehend mit verschiedenen stellen konkrete codebeispiele bereit. <

1. basisselektor< h3>

der basisselektor einfachste am häufigsten verwendete selektortyp jquery. sie elemente anhand ihres tag-namens, ihrer id klassennamens auswählen. beispiel: p>

 通过标签名选择 $('div').css('color', 'red'); 通过id选择 $('#myid').fadeout(); 通过类名选择 $('.myclass').slideup();< pre>
nach dem login kopieren< div>< div>

2. hierarchischer selektor< h3>

der hierarchische selektor kann unter angegebenen element untergeordnete elemente, usw. zu gängigen hierarchischen gehören elementselektoren >< code>, nachkommenselektoren, leerzeichen 后代选择器空格等。< 选取子元素 $('ul li').css('background-color', 'yellow'); 选取后代元素 $('form input').attr('disabled', 'true');< div>

3. 过滤选择器< h3>

过滤选择器允许开发者筛选出满足特定条件的元素,常见的过滤选择器包括:first< :last< :even< :odd< code>等。< 选取第一个元素 $('li:first').addclass('highlight'); 选取偶数位置元素 $('tr:even').css('background-color', 'lightgrey');< div>

4. 内容选择器< h3>

内容选择器是根据元素的文本内容来选择元素,常见的内容选择器有:contains()< code>。< 选择包含“hello”的元素 $('p:contains("hello")').addclass('greeting');< div>

5. 状态选择器< h3>

状态选择器可以根据元素的状态来选择元素,比如可见状态、隐藏状态等,常见的状态选择器有:visible< :hidden< 选取可见元素 $('img:visible').fadein(); 选取隐藏元素 $('div:hidden').slidedown();< div>

6. 表单选择器< h3>

表单选择器用于选择表单元素,比如输入框、复选框、下拉框等。常见的表单选择器有:input< :checkbox< :radio< :button< code>

3. mit filterselektor entwickler herausfiltern, bestimmte erfüllen: :first< : gerade< :ungerade< code>

rrreee< p>4. inhaltsselektor🎜🎜der inhaltsselektor wählt ihrem textinhalt aus. 🎜rrreee🎜5. statusselektor🎜🎜der statusselektor entsprechend status auswählen, z. b. sichtbarer status, versteckter statusselektoren :visible< :hidden. 🎜rrreee🎜6. formularauswahl🎜🎜die formularauswahl wird zum auswählen formularelementen wie eingabefeldern, kontrollkästchen, dropdown-boxen verwendet. formularselektoren :input< 🎜rrreee🎜durch flexible anwendung oben genannten effizienter betreiben verschiedene dynamische effekte interaktionen erzielen. tatsächlichen entwicklung muss verwendung je nach szenario flexibel ausgewählt werden, um wartbarkeit skalierbarkeit verbessern. ich hoffe, dass leser durch einleitung dieses artikels tieferes verständnis erlangen sie geschickter für erledigung verschiedener aufgaben einsetzen können. 🎜< code>

Das obige ist der detaillierte Inhalt vonEin tiefer Einblick in die verschiedenen Selektortypen in jQuery.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age
Über uns Haftungsausschluss Sitemap
Chinesische PHP-Website:Online-PHP-Schulung für das Gemeinwohl,Helfen Sie PHP-Lernenden, sich schnell weiterzuentwickeln!